FAQ Section

Is it legal to watch cartoons on these sites?

The legality depends on the site. Official network sites are legal. Unofficial sites may be operating in a grey area, and it’s your responsibility to be aware of copyright laws in your region.

Are these sites safe to use?

Safety varies. Stick to reputable sites and use ad blockers and VPNs for added protection. Avoid clicking on suspicious links or downloading anything from untrusted sources.

Do I need to create an account to watch cartoons?

Some sites require an account, while others don’t. Creating an account may offer benefits like personalized recommendations and watchlists.

Are these sites really free?

Yes, the sites listed offer free content, but many rely on advertisements to support their operations.
